Employee lifecycle analytics integrates data from recruitment, onboarding, development, retention, and offboarding to provide end-to-end visibility into workforce dynamics. These analytics draw from diverse sources such as HRIS, payroll, engagement platforms, and learningmanagement systems to deliver a holistic view of employee journeys.

A performance management system refers to the processes a company uses to align, measure, and improve employee performance. It’s the framework that ensures your team understands their goals, takes accountability for achieving them, and continuously develops their skills.
